Write an equation in slope-intercept form for the line that passes through the given point and is parallel
to the graph of given equation.
11. (3, −2) , y = x + 4
ANSWER: y=x−5
13. (0, 2) , y = −5x + 8
ANSWER: y = −5x + 2

ANSWER: Determine whether the graphs of each pair of equations are parallel , perpendicular , or neither.
33. y = 4x + 3
4x + y = 3
ANSWER: neither
35. 3x + 5y = 10
5x − 3y = −6
ANSWER: perpendicular
37. 2x + 5y = 15
3x + 5y = 15
ANSWER: neither
